Verilen kuyruktan bir veya daha fazla tensörün tuple'larını kuyruktan çıkarır.
Bu işlem tüm kuyruklar tarafından desteklenmez. Bir kuyruk DequeueUpTo'yu desteklemiyorsa, Uygulanmamış bir hata döndürülür.
Kuyruk kapalıysa ve 0'dan fazla ancak "n"den az öğe kaldıysa, QueueDequeueMany gibi bir OutOfRange hatası döndürmek yerine, "n"den az öğe hemen döndürülür. Kuyruk kapalıysa ve kuyrukta 0 öğe kaldıysa QueueDequeueMany'de olduğu gibi OutOfRange hatası döndürülür. Aksi takdirde davranış QueueDequeueMany ile aynıdır:
Bu işlem, tek bir bileşen tensörü oluşturmak için kuyruk öğesi bileşen tensörlerini 0'ıncı boyut boyunca birleştirir. Sıradan çıkarılan demetteki tüm bileşenler 0'ıncı boyutta n boyutuna sahip olacaktır.
Bu işlemin "k" çıktıları vardır; burada "k", verilen kuyrukta depolanan demetlerdeki bileşenlerin sayısıdır ve "i" çıkışı, kuyruğundan çıkarılan demetin i'inci bileşenidir.
İç İçe Sınıflar
sınıf | QueueDequeueUpTo.Options | QueueDequeueUpTo için isteğe bağlı özellikler |
Sabitler
Sicim | OP_NAME | Bu operasyonun TensorFlow çekirdek motoru tarafından bilinen adı |
Genel Yöntemler
Liste< Çıkış <?>> | bileşenler () Bir demet olarak sıraya alınmış bir veya daha fazla tensör. |
statik QueueDequeueUpTo | |
Yineleyici< İşlenen < TType >> | yineleyici () |
statik QueueDequeueUpTo.Options | timeoutMs (Uzun zaman aşımıMs) |
Kalıtsal Yöntemler
Sabitler
genel statik son Dize OP_NAME
Bu operasyonun TensorFlow çekirdek motoru tarafından bilinen adı
Genel Yöntemler
public static QueueDequeueUpTo create ( Kapsam kapsamı, İşlenen <?> tanıtıcı, İşlenen < TInt32 > n, Liste<Sınıf<?, TType'ı genişletir >> bileşen Türleri, Seçenekler... seçenekler)
Yeni bir QueueDequeueUpTo işlemini saran bir sınıf oluşturmaya yönelik fabrika yöntemi.
Parametreler
kapsam | mevcut kapsam |
---|---|
halletmek | Bir kuyruğun tanıtıcısı. |
N | Sıradan çıkarılacak demetlerin sayısı. |
bileşen Türleri | Bir demetteki her bileşenin türü. |
seçenekler | isteğe bağlı nitelik değerlerini taşır |
İadeler
- QueueDequeueUpTo'nun yeni bir örneği
public static QueueDequeueUpTo.Options timeoutMs (Uzun zaman aşımıMs)
Parametreler
zaman aşımıMs | Kuyrukta n'den az öğe varsa, bu işlem timeout_ms milisaniyeye kadar engelleyecektir. Not: Bu seçenek henüz desteklenmemektedir. |
---|
Verilen kuyruktan bir veya daha fazla tensörün tuple'larını kuyruktan çıkarır.
Bu işlem tüm kuyruklar tarafından desteklenmez. Bir kuyruk DequeueUpTo'yu desteklemiyorsa, Uygulanmamış bir hata döndürülür.
Kuyruk kapalıysa ve 0'dan fazla ancak "n"den az öğe kaldıysa, QueueDequeueMany gibi bir OutOfRange hatası döndürmek yerine, "n"den az öğe hemen döndürülür. Kuyruk kapalıysa ve kuyrukta 0 öğe kaldıysa QueueDequeueMany'de olduğu gibi OutOfRange hatası döndürülür. Aksi takdirde davranış QueueDequeueMany ile aynıdır:
Bu işlem, tek bir bileşen tensörü oluşturmak için kuyruk öğesi bileşen tensörlerini 0'ıncı boyut boyunca birleştirir. Sıradan çıkarılan demetteki tüm bileşenler 0'ıncı boyutta n boyutuna sahip olacaktır.
Bu işlemin "k" çıktıları vardır; burada "k", verilen kuyrukta depolanan demetlerdeki bileşenlerin sayısıdır ve "i" çıkışı, kuyruğundan çıkarılan demetin i'inci bileşenidir.
İç İçe Sınıflar
sınıf | QueueDequeueUpTo.Options | QueueDequeueUpTo için isteğe bağlı özellikler |
Sabitler
Sicim | OP_NAME | Bu operasyonun TensorFlow çekirdek motoru tarafından bilinen adı |
Genel Yöntemler
Liste< Çıkış <?>> | bileşenler () Bir demet olarak sıraya alınmış bir veya daha fazla tensör. |
statik QueueDequeueUpTo | |
Yineleyici< İşlenen < TType >> | yineleyici () |
statik QueueDequeueUpTo.Options | timeoutMs (Uzun zaman aşımıMs) |
Kalıtsal Yöntemler
Sabitler
genel statik son Dize OP_NAME
Bu operasyonun TensorFlow çekirdek motoru tarafından bilinen adı
Genel Yöntemler
public static QueueDequeueUpTo create ( Kapsam kapsamı, İşlenen <?> tanıtıcı, İşlenen < TInt32 > n, Liste<Sınıf<?, TType'ı genişletir >> bileşen Türleri, Seçenekler... seçenekler)
Yeni bir QueueDequeueUpTo işlemini saran bir sınıf oluşturmaya yönelik fabrika yöntemi.
Parametreler
kapsam | mevcut kapsam |
---|---|
halletmek | Bir kuyruğun tanıtıcısı. |
N | Sıradan çıkarılacak demetlerin sayısı. |
bileşen Türleri | Bir demetteki her bileşenin türü. |
seçenekler | isteğe bağlı nitelik değerlerini taşır |
İadeler
- QueueDequeueUpTo'nun yeni bir örneği
public static QueueDequeueUpTo.Options timeoutMs (Uzun zaman aşımıMs)
Parametreler
zaman aşımıMs | Kuyrukta n'den az öğe varsa, bu işlem timeout_ms milisaniyeye kadar engelleyecektir. Not: Bu seçenek henüz desteklenmemektedir. |
---|